Introduction to Airtight Cleanroom Doors


The healthcare industry is under constant pressure to maintain the highest standards of hygiene and safety. In this context, **airtight cleanroom doors** are essential components of controlled environments where medical equipment is stored and handled. These specialized doors offer numerous advantages that support the safety and performance of sensitive medical instruments and devices.

Importance of Airtight Cleanroom Doors in Medical Equipment


Airtight cleanroom doors are engineered to create a controlled environment that minimizes contamination risks. In settings such as laboratories, surgical suites, and pharmaceutical manufacturing facilities, even the slightest impurity can compromise the efficacy of medical equipment. Here, we explore several reasons why these doors are crucial:

Effective Contamination Control


**Contamination control** is paramount in the medical field. Airtight cleanroom doors prevent the ingress of airborne particles, microbes, and pollutants, ensuring that the environment remains sterile. This is particularly critical in operating rooms or places where surgeries are performed.

Environmental Stability


Airtight doors help maintain **stable environmental conditions**, including temperature, humidity, and pressure. This stability is essential for the proper functioning of sensitive medical devices. For instance, certain surgical instruments require specific temperature and humidity levels to remain effective and safe for use.

Cost Efficiency


Investing in airtight cleanroom doors can lead to **long-term cost savings**. By reducing the risk of contamination and damage to medical equipment, healthcare facilities can minimize unexpected expenses associated with repairs, replacements, or even lawsuits arising from equipment failure.

Key Features of Airtight Cleanroom Doors


Airtight cleanroom doors are not just ordinary doors; they are designed with specific features that enhance their functionality in medical settings:

High-Quality Materials


These doors are typically constructed from **stainless steel**, **aluminum**, or specialized plastics that provide durability and resistance to corrosion. The choice of material plays a significant role in maintaining cleanliness and ensuring the longevity of the door.

Advanced Sealing Mechanisms


The efficacy of airtight cleanroom doors lies in their **sealing mechanisms**. High-performance seals prevent air leaks and ensure that the door remains airtight, even under varying pressure conditions. This feature is crucial for maintaining a sterile environment.

Accessibility Features


Many airtight cleanroom doors come equipped with **automated access systems**, making it easier for personnel to enter and exit without compromising the sterile environment. This is particularly beneficial in high-traffic areas within medical facilities.

Types of Airtight Cleanroom Doors for Medical Use


Understanding the different types of airtight cleanroom doors can help healthcare facilities make informed choices based on their specific needs:

Manual Airtight Doors


Manual airtight doors are operated by hand and are ideal for areas with less foot traffic. These doors often feature robust seals and durable construction to maintain an airtight environment.

Automatic Airtight Doors


Automatic airtight doors facilitate easy access while maintaining cleanliness. These doors are commonly installed in high-traffic areas, such as surgical suites, where quick and easy entry and exit are necessary.

Sliding Airtight Doors


Sliding airtight doors are an excellent option for situations where space is limited. These doors save space while providing an effective barrier against contaminants.

Compliance and Standards for Cleanroom Doors


Compliance with guidelines set by organizations such as the **Food and Drug Administration (FDA)** and **International Organization for Standardization (ISO)** is mandatory for all medical facilities. Airtight cleanroom doors must adhere to these regulations to ensure that they provide the necessary protection.

ISO Standards for Cleanrooms


ISO standards, particularly **ISO 14644**, outline the requirements for cleanroom environments. Ensuring that airtight cleanroom doors meet these standards is crucial for maintaining an uncontaminated atmosphere.

FDA Regulations


The FDA imposes strict guidelines regarding the cleanliness of environments where medical devices are manufactured and stored. Airtight cleanroom doors must be compliant with these regulations to ensure that healthcare facilities can operate effectively and legally.

Installation and Maintenance of Airtight Cleanroom Doors


Proper installation and maintenance are critical to the performance of airtight cleanroom doors. Here are key considerations:

Importance of Professional Installation


While it may be tempting to attempt DIY installation, professional installation ensures that doors are fitted correctly and function optimally. Well-fitted doors provide better sealing and reduce the risk of contamination.

Regular Maintenance for Longevity


Routine maintenance is essential for the longevity of airtight cleanroom doors. Regular inspections can identify potential issues before they become significant problems. This includes checking seals, hinges, and other components for wear and tear.
